Kopi luwak is a coffee that consists of partially digested coffee cherries which were eaten and defecated by the Asian palm civet Paradoxurus hermaphroditusIt is therefore also called civet coffeeThe cherries are fermented as they pass through a civets intestines and after being defecated with other fecal matter they are collected.
